1. Dynamic Menu Boards Are Now a Standard

Static menu boards are officially outdated. Customers want quick, clear visuals — and digital menus deliver just that. With a digital signage wall placed strategically at the counter or ordering point, restaurants are using vibrant images and real-time updates to influence decisions at the moment of purchase.

Time-based pricing, sold-out alerts, or even allergen icons can be updated instantly without needing a reprint. Plus, animated transitions between breakfast and lunch menus create a smooth experience for both staff and customers.

 2. QR-Enhanced Signage for Contactless Convenience

QR codes aren't new, but combining them with digital signage creates a seamless, touch-free journey. Customers can scan a code from the screen to view the full menu, order, pay, or even leave feedback — all without waiting for a server.

This type of digital signage restaurant setup not only reduces friction but also shortens queues and improves order accuracy. It’s fast, clean, and exactly what today’s diners expect.

 3. Personalization and AI Are Enhancing Engagement

Smart signage is becoming smarter. Some restaurants are now using AI-driven content to display promotions based on weather, time, or customer behavior. For instance, a coffee shop might promote iced drinks during the afternoon heat, or highlight combo meals during lunch rush.

This trend in restaurant digital signage helps increase average ticket size and gives customers a more tailored experience. Instead of generic ads, they see what's most relevant — at just the right moment.

 4. Interior Aesthetics Meet Functionality with Digital Signage Walls

Aesthetics matter — and digital signage walls are no longer just utility tools. Restaurants are using them as part of their interior design. Think of a giant LED screen displaying a cozy fireplace in a winter-themed café or showing live kitchen footage in an open-concept bistro.

These walls don’t just inform; they immerse. They turn ambiance into an active brand asset, helping you stand out in an Instagram-driven world where vibe equals value.

 5. Cloud-Based Control Across Locations

For restaurant chains or franchises, managing signage across multiple outlets used to be a nightmare. Not anymore.

Thanks to cloud-based platforms, updates to menu boards, promotions, or branding can be pushed to every screen in real-time — from one central dashboard. This ensures brand consistency and allows rapid response to changing trends or supply chain issues.

This evolution in digital signage for restaurant businesses is saving both time and operational headaches.

 6. Data-Driven Signage to Understand Customer Behavior

Modern signage is not just about displaying content — it’s about learning from it too.

Some systems now offer analytics dashboards that tell you which menu items got the most views, what promotions worked best, or when your display had the highest engagement. This kind of insight helps optimize content strategy just like any digital marketing channel.

It turns your screens into silent data collectors, giving you feedback that can improve sales and service.

 The Road Ahead: What's Next?

The future of digital signage restaurant technology is only getting more exciting. Expect to see voice-activated displays, facial recognition for loyalty members (with full consent, of course), and even real-time translation for tourist-friendly spots.
